Transaction e90ec2add71d65dc3ccb0d123f78f521b9b273f3e9c08caa01b95c7ca1a38875

1 Input
2 Outputs
  • e90ec2add71d65dc3ccb0d123f78f521b9b273f3e9c08caa01b95c7ca1a38875:0
  • value  11539196932
    address  1G2aroMHJPhrEeEgWt7EKS5ka6nf4YAw2k
  • e90ec2add71d65dc3ccb0d123f78f521b9b273f3e9c08caa01b95c7ca1a38875:1
  • value  108000000
    address  3FmZesCNBzUnJdBL8pEndG8XZJB7xwDXqx